Reflected XSS in MiniGal Nano index.php via dir Parameter

Description
MiniGal Nano version 0.3.5 and prior contain a reflected cross-site scripting (XSS) vulnerability in index.php via the dir parameter. The application constructs $currentdir from user-controlled input and embeds it into an error message without output encoding, allowing an attacker to supply HTML/JavaScript that is reflected in the response. Successful exploitation can lead to execution of arbitrary script in a victim's browser in the context of the vulnerable application.

CWE ID Description
CWE-79 The product does not neutralize or incorrectly neutralizes user-controllable input before it is placed in output that is used as a web page that is served to other users.
